Fishbowl Inventory 2011.7 Release

The newest maintenance release of Fishbowl, version 2011.7 was released earlier this month. It has fixed approximately 130 open issues. The most notable feature improvements are below:

• The communication between Fishbowl and QuickBooks is faster and more efficient
• Uploaded Reports replaces files rather than creating additional files report (2), report (3),….
• Compatible with QuickBooks versions 2009 and newer as QuickBooks is discontinuing support of 2008 QB.
• Updated to iReport version 4.0.2.
• Added the PO global address search back into the purchase order module.
• Improved the speed of issuing / unissuing a sales order with MO’s attached.

Your First Hour With QuickBooks

When you open up QuickBooks for the first time, you are entering a completely new world, one that could be incredibly overwhelming without any help.  Fortunately, the program comes with a Setup Wizard that will help walk you through some of the first steps necessary to use the program to keep track of your finances.

The Setup Wizard will ask quite a few questions.  While this tool’s content varies in different versions, you will be providing information about how your company is structured by, for example, selecting a Chart of Accounts that suits your business. You’ll tell QuickBooks which features to turn on and off (like inventory and bill-pay), and you’ll save your company file. Continue reading
